Hey all, I have a few questions about buying a 4th gen Max for my daily driver. Keep in mind that I will be putting on average 30k miles or so a year on it.
My budget is up to around $3500 tops but I'm worried that if I get one with too high of miles that all of a sudden I'm going to start dumping tons of cash into it. Ideally, what would be the highest amount of mileage I should be looking for? Its hard to find any 4th gens with less than 120k miles on them for less than like $5,000 around here.
Also, what kinds of issues should I be looking for with a Max with this many miles?

had my 95 gle for about 2 yrs now. purchased it for $3500 with 158k on it. So far i've put in a new fuel pump, steering rack, lower control arm, 2 fuel injector's, radiator, Bose head unit and I have to re-charge the A/C every couple weeks due to a hole in the evaporator that one day i'll get around to replacing, if the motor doesn't blow up first. But seriously, with 186k on it now it's still a nice car. Plus learning to work on it isn't that bad due to all the info and help this forum provides.

Miles mean nothing with these cars, and I mean that in every way. There's no magical number of miles where a given part is going to fail, or even a range of miles really. Other than maintenance items and stuff I've CHOSEN to replace, everything on my car is original at 140k+. Looking for one with a set amount of miles isn't going to help you much, more so looking for one that has been well taken care of and has documented maintenance.
